The Dead Sea Scrolls A New Translation Michael Owen Wise, Martin G. Abegg, and Edward M. Cook - 1 st - U.S.A Harper San Francisco 1996 - 513tr. Paperback, Illustration 24 cm
This landmark work comes from a new generation of Dead Sea Scrolls scholars. Wise, Abegg and Cook bring the long-inaccessible ancient scrolls of Qumran to life, translating and deciphering virtually every legible portion of the fragmented scrolls. This book contains: intriguing revelations about biblical history and the roots of Christianity
